Job Title: Transportation Operator I

Join the Virginia Department of Transportation as a Transportation Operator I and contribute to the maintenance and upkeep of our state's transportation infrastructure.

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ented individual to perform manual labor and other maintenance tasks as needed for project completion. As a Transportation Operator I, you will be responsible for flagging traffic, assisting in setting up work zones, performing manual labor on roadway maintenance work crews, and driving pick-ups and one-ton trucks.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Flag traffic and assist in setting up work zones
  • Perform manual labor on roadway maintenance work crews
  • Drive pick-ups and one-ton trucks
  • Perform preventive maintenance and minor repairs on vehicles and equipment
Requirements:
  • Ability to perform heavy manual labor
  • Ability to remain constantly aware and observant of surroundings to maintain safe work zones for workers and the traveling public
  • Ability to stand for long periods of time
  • Valid driver's license
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ience in roadway maintenance and flagging operations
  • Experience in equipment operation and performing preventive maintenance
  • A combination of training, experience, or education in Maintenance, Construction, or related field
